Siamo have collaborated with a premium recruitment agency who specialise within the accounts and finance industry within Cirencester who are looking for a motivated, hungry Graduate Recruitment Consultant to join their growing team.

As a Recruitment Consultant you will manage the candidate generation process and work alongside the talented senior consultants to make successful placements for large clients.

How to prepare for a job interview at United Cerebral Palsy of Georgia

Know Your Finance Stuff

Brush up on your knowledge of the finance sector. Understand key terms and trends that are currently shaping the industry. This will not only impress your interviewers but also show that you're genuinely interested in the field.

Show Your Motivation

As a Graduate Recruitment Consultant, enthusiasm is key! Be ready to share why you’re excited about this role and how it aligns with your career goals. A genuine passion for recruitment and finance can set you apart from other candidates.

Prepare Questions

Interviews are a two-way street. Prepare thoughtful questions about the company culture, team dynamics, and growth opportunities within the agency. This shows that you’re engaged and serious about finding the right fit for both you and the company.

Practice Your Pitch

You’ll likely need to sell yourself during the interview. Practice a concise pitch about your background, skills, and what you bring to the table. Tailor it to highlight your suitability for the recruitment consultant role in the finance sector.
